‘Why as a mother I want a crowded agenda’ | kek mama

Active kids

‘All I have to do is pick up my kids from school or a day out, and they’re already asking what we’re going to do next,’ says Amber. ‘My children, one of 8 and twins of 6, are very social and active. They got that from me, because I also do all kinds of things: yoga, running, crossfit, working, meeting friends. The children grew up with that. They are used to people walking in and out of our house and that we often go out. They really need that bustle.’

Irritations

Amber does not understand families who stay at home all day to laze and relax. ‘My children can enjoy themselves just fine, but being at home too much does make them excited and irritated at a certain point. I also get a hundred more questions and they want more snacks.’ It quickly becomes a nightmare, Amber describes. “I’m going to scream, because my annoyances are mounting, and I like my children less.”

only adventure

It doesn’t get any more fun for the children themselves. ‘They do play games and build the biggest fortresses with their toys, but they are also happier if we go outside to do something. That’s why we often go cycling, to the park, the library or the swimming pool – sometimes all on the same day. We go from one adventure to another. For some families such a busy schedule will be too much, but it works for us.’
